Output 89b58097c7aa2c8e30e1b59f6ad792657f63d0b228c778283aaba3e55656df52:61

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 45664255c82235387d212189f2172cabb67b21682769644c4f2a170870e2e623
address
bc1pg4nyy4wgyg6nslfpyxyly9ev4wm8kgtgya5kgnz09gtssu8zuc3s2p3fn7
transaction
89b58097c7aa2c8e30e1b59f6ad792657f63d0b228c778283aaba3e55656df52
spent
true